Woman in Severe Condition After Being Burned in a Motel Room Fire

Image

CHATSWORTH- A woman was found severely burned and transported to a vicinity hospital in grave condition, after a fire burst through a second-floor unit, of a two-story motel, at 21902 West Lassen Street.

The blaze erupted on January 15, 2023, at 4:30 a.m., When officials arrived at the scene, the fire sprinkler activation had extinguished the flames in the motel room.

An additional person was assessed for symptoms of nominal smoke inhalation and treated by  LAFD medics, and released on scene. LAPD was also at the scene.

LAFD Fire Investigators will determine the cause of the fire.
